Официальное название
Real Life Non-interventional Study on Safety and Effectiveness of Ilaris® (Canakinumab) 150 mg for Subcutaneous Injection in Hereditary Periodic Fever Syndrome (CAPS, crFMF, TRAPS and HIDS/MKD) Patients and sJIA Patients (REASSURE)
Обзор
This is a study to evaluate safety and effectiveness of Ilaris in adult and pediatric patients receiving the drug in a clinical setting for any of the following indications, Hereditary Periodic Fever Syndromes, Cryopyrin-associated periodic syndromes (CAPS), colchicine resistance familial Mediterranean fever (crFMF), TNF receptor associated periodic syndrome (TRAPS), Hyper-IgD syndrome / Mevalonate kinase deficiency (HIDS/MKD) or Systemic juvenile idiopathic arthritis (sJIA).
Подробное описание
This is a prospective observational, multicenter, uncontrolled, open-label non-interventional study in ≥2 year and \<19 year-old pediatric and ≥19 year-old adult hereditary periodic fever syndrome patients and ≥2 year and \<19 year-old sJIA patients receiving Ilaris for the treatment of CAPS, crFMF, TRAPS, HIDS/MKD and sJIA, respectively, partially using retrospective observation to collect and evaluate data on the safety and effectiveness of Ilaris in patients receiving this drug in a clinical setting for any of these indications. The whole study period is up to 4 years, consisting of a 2-year enrollment period and 2-year observation period.
As all pediatric and adult hereditary periodic fever syndrome patients and all sJIA patients receiving Ilaris for approved indications will be enrolled, this study has no fixed sample size.
For subjects who started Ilaris before enrolling in this study, the safety and effectiveness baseline and early period data will be retrospectively collected.

Первичные конечные точки
- Incidence of adverse events and serious adverse events [Срок оценки: Up to 104 weeks from Ilaris treatment]
Вторичные конечные точки (9)
- Proportion of complete responders [Срок оценки: Up to 16 weeks from Liars treatment]
- Proportion of participants with Physician Global Assessment of Disease Activity (PGA) score <2 [Срок оценки: Up to 104 weeks from Ilaris treatment]
- Proportion of patients with C- reactive protein (CRP) serological response [Срок оценки: Up to 104 weeks from Ilaris treatment]
- Proportions of patients with serum amyloid A (SAA) normalization [Срок оценки: Up to 104 weeks from Ilaris treatment]
- Proportion of patients classified in each severity level in the physician's severity assessment of key disease -specific signs and symptoms [Срок оценки: Up to 104 weeks from Ilaris treatment]
- Proportions of patients classified in each severity level in symptoms likely to significantly affect affect physical functioning and vital prognosis [Срок оценки: Up to 104 weeks from Ilaris treatment]
- Percent change from baseline in Health related quality of life (HRQOL) measured by Child Health Questionnaire-Parent Form 50 (CHQ-PF50) [Срок оценки: Up to 104 weeks from Ilaris treatment]
- Percent change from baseline in Health related quality of life (HRQOL) measured by 36-item Short Form Health Survey (SF-36) [Срок оценки: Up to 104 weeks from Ilaris treatment]
- Percent change from baseline in Health related quality of life (HRQOL) measured by Work Productivity and Activity Impairment Specific Health Problem v2.0 (WPAI-SHP) [Срок оценки: Up to 104 weeks from Ilaris treatment]
Критерии участия
Критерии включения
- Written informed consent/assent of the patient or their legal representative/parent (≥2 year and <19 year-old pediatric patient) for voluntarily participating in this study
- Age: ≥2 year and <19 year-old pediatric and ≥19 year-old adult hereditary periodic fever syndrome (CAPS, crFMF, TRAPS and HIDS/MKD) patients and ≥2 year and <19 year-old sJIA patients
- Patient who have an agreement to be treated or who have already started treatment with Ilaris in accordance with the approved label information
Критерии исключения
- Patients receiving Ilaris treatment for autoimmune disease other than CAPS, crFMF, TRAPS, HIDS/MKD or sJIA
- Patients participating in an interventional clinical trial which would have an impact on routine clinical treatment
